Most of what these guys are telling you is true, having spent 10yrs towing caravans and salvage trailers around the north island you do need a big tow wagon to pull up without brakes. also if you do make one go tandem and as low as you can get it but also as wide a deck, nothing like going to get a car and finding it dont fit up on the trailer !!

    Mine is about 25 yrs old now and is 4.3 mtr by 2 mtr deck and there are still car i cant fit on it.

    dont use rocker suspension use duratouques mine had rocker and as soon as it got a flat it ripped the tyre up, its now a solid lowloader and much better, can even tow on 3 wheels...lol....also get "2" spares for it you just never know.

    Aslo remember the tow vehical MUST weigh more than the trailer and whats on it!!! and yes there are new reg's about how much you can tow and with what, look it up at transit NZ, my car and trailer with race car on it weigh in at about 3300 on the road, ready to go to track.

Hey guys iv towed small car trailers, large ones and all sorts, but towing with a A frame i didnt like because it will push you and it scuffs the front tyres of the car on thee frame, if you want to go this way use a braked dolly with steering, iv done it and found it was like towing large braked trailer.

    check out on the net there are plans for braked and steering dollys, go this way instead of A frame.
